Loading src/com/android/packageinstaller/permission/utils/Utils.java +4 −9 Original line number Diff line number Diff line Loading @@ -59,7 +59,6 @@ import android.graphics.Bitmap; import android.graphics.drawable.BitmapDrawable; import android.graphics.drawable.Drawable; import android.os.Parcelable; import android.os.Process; import android.os.UserHandle; import android.os.UserManager; import android.provider.DeviceConfig; Loading Loading @@ -720,16 +719,12 @@ public final class Utils { public static @NonNull Drawable getBadgedIcon(@NonNull Context context, @NonNull ApplicationInfo appInfo) { UserHandle user = UserHandle.getUserHandleForUid(appInfo.uid); if (Process.myUserHandle().equals(user)) { return appInfo.loadIcon(context.getPackageManager()); } else { try (IconFactory iconFactory = IconFactory.obtain(context)) { Bitmap iconBmp = iconFactory.createBadgedIconBitmap( appInfo.loadUnbadgedIcon(context.getPackageManager()), user, false).icon; return new BitmapDrawable(context.getResources(), iconBmp); } } } /** * Get a string saying what apps with the given permission group can do. Loading Loading
src/com/android/packageinstaller/permission/utils/Utils.java +4 −9 Original line number Diff line number Diff line Loading @@ -59,7 +59,6 @@ import android.graphics.Bitmap; import android.graphics.drawable.BitmapDrawable; import android.graphics.drawable.Drawable; import android.os.Parcelable; import android.os.Process; import android.os.UserHandle; import android.os.UserManager; import android.provider.DeviceConfig; Loading Loading @@ -720,16 +719,12 @@ public final class Utils { public static @NonNull Drawable getBadgedIcon(@NonNull Context context, @NonNull ApplicationInfo appInfo) { UserHandle user = UserHandle.getUserHandleForUid(appInfo.uid); if (Process.myUserHandle().equals(user)) { return appInfo.loadIcon(context.getPackageManager()); } else { try (IconFactory iconFactory = IconFactory.obtain(context)) { Bitmap iconBmp = iconFactory.createBadgedIconBitmap( appInfo.loadUnbadgedIcon(context.getPackageManager()), user, false).icon; return new BitmapDrawable(context.getResources(), iconBmp); } } } /** * Get a string saying what apps with the given permission group can do. Loading